MAX7414EUA+ by Analog Devices

5th-Order, Lowpass, Switched-Capacitor Filters


The MAX7409/MAX7410/MAX7413/MAX7414 5th-order, lowpass, switched-capacitor filters (SCFs) operate from a single +5V (MAX7409/MAX7410) or +3V (MAX7413/ MAX7414) supply. These devices draw only 1.2mA of supply current and allow corner frequencies from 1Hz to 15kHz, making them ideal for low-power post-DAC filtering and anti-aliasing applications. They feature a shutdown mode, which reduces the supply current to 0.2µA. Two clocking options are available on these devices: self-clocking (through the use of an external capacitor) or external clocking for tighter corner-frequency control. An offset adjust pin allows for adjustment of the DC output level. The MAX7409/MAX7413 Bessel filters provide low overshoot and fast settling, while the MAX7410/MAX7414 Butterworth filters provide a maximally flat passband response. Their fixed response simplifies the design task to selecting a clock frequency.

Features

5th-Order Lowpass Filters Bessel Response (MAX7409/MAX7413) Butterworth Response (MAX7410/MAX7414)
Bessel Response (MAX7409/MAX7413)
Butterworth Response (MAX7410/MAX7414)
Clock-Tunable Corner Frequency (1Hz to 15kHz)
Single-Supply Operation +5V (MAX7409/MAX7410) +3V (MAX7413/MAX7414)
+5V (MAX7409/MAX7410)
+3V (MAX7413/MAX7414)
Low Power 1.2mA (operating mode) 0.2µA (shutdown mode)
1.2mA (operating mode)
0.2µA (shutdown mode)
Available in 8-Pin µMAX®/DIP Packages
Low Output Offset: ±4mV
